Overview

Reliable Wireless Intercom Base Station

The Telex BTR-800 Base Station is a reliable wireless intercom base station designed for professional communication. With a backlit LCD for easy monitoring and a rugged design, this base station provides clear and dependable wireless communication in various environments.

  • Brand: Telex
  • Model: BTR-800-H3R
  • Features: Backlit Base Station LCD
  • Mounting: Table or Rackmountable
  • Beltpack Housing: Weather and shock resistant die cast magnesium case
  • Frequency Range: 500 - 518 MHz
  • Headset Jack: A4F
  • Band: H3 BAND
